On the 13th anniversary of the passing of former Nigerian President, Umar Musa Yar'Adua, President-elect Bola Ahmed Tinubu paid tribute to the late leader, extolling his virtues and promising to follow his good examples.

In a statement released on Saturday, May 6, 2023, Tinubu praised Yar'Adua's excellent performance as the governor of Katsina State and later as President of Nigeria. He acknowledged Yar'Adua's outstanding leadership qualities and his commitment to promoting unity and peaceful coexistence in the country.

As Tinubu prepares to assume office on May 29, he expressed his determination to emulate the good examples set by leaders like Yar'Adua, whom he described as a symbol of selfless service and dedication to the Nigerian people.

Tinubu's tribute to Yar'Adua highlights the importance of recognizing and honoring past leaders who have made significant contributions to the development of Nigeria. It also underscores the need for current and future leaders to learn from the examples of their predecessors and strive to build on their legacies.

The statement titled ‘We will never forget you’ partly reads; “Today, as always, I remember my good friend and brother in the struggle for democracy and good governance in Nigeria, late President Umaru Musa Yar’Adua, who died on this day 13 years ago.

“May 5, 2010 may have long gone but, for some of us, the wound is still fresh. We remember the day as much as we remember the purposeful life lived by Mallam Umaru Yar’Adua.
